Abstract
Langerhans cells belong to the dendritic cell family. Their presence in the conjunctiva and cornea has been demonstrated by means of various membrane and cytoplasmic markers. Utilizing OKT6, a monoclonal antibody that specifically binds to Langerhans cells in conjunction with la histocompatibility antigens (HLA-DR), and a new panel of monoclonal antibodies, we compared the population density and characteristic phenotypes of Langerhans cells in normal conjunctiva with those in normal epidermis. A greater density of Langerhans cells was noted in epidermis in comparison with conjunctiva. Various areas of the conjunctiva and cornea were mapped for Langerhans cell distribution. The T6/la ratio of Langerhans cells in conjunctiva was notably different from that in skin. Utilizing the Prolm2 marker, we identified non-Langerhans dendritic cells in the substantia propria and in the basilar epithelium of the conjunctiva, antigen-processing cells probably identical to the interdigitating dendritic cells of lymph nodes.
